Increasing the speed of Decision MakingOne of the key issues facing simulation modellers is the time it takes to run simulation models. Typical models may take 40 minutes or more to run a single replication, and with a typical scenario needing to be run for at least 10 replications, the results for any scenario can be a source of significant delay. When you then realise how many scenar- ios a user may like to run, not to mention the runs used to test and validate a model, the workload can be significant.Saker Solutions have worked with Brunel University on an R&D project looking into Distributed Simulation. The first phase of this work has resulted in the development of a product to enable simulation users to easily distribute scenarios across a local Grid achieving a near linear improvement in response performance.
